Foros del Web » Programación para mayores de 30 ;) » Java »

Error Pool De Tomcat

Estas en el tema de Error Pool De Tomcat en el foro de Java en Foros del Web. Hola estoy configurando un pool de conexiones con TomCat 5.0.30 y Oracle 9i. Os comento lo que he hecho y luego os digo el error ...
  #1 (permalink)  
Antiguo 08/10/2005, 10:35
 
Fecha de Ingreso: mayo-2005
Mensajes: 294
Antigüedad: 19 años
Puntos: 0
Error Pool De Tomcat

Hola estoy configurando un pool de conexiones con TomCat 5.0.30 y Oracle 9i. Os comento lo que he hecho y luego os digo el error que me da a ver si podeis ayudarme.El server.xml lo he configurado asi:

<Host name="localhost" debug="0" appBase="webapps" unpackWARs="true" autoDeploy="true" xmlValidation="false" xmlNamespaceAware="false">
<DefaultContext>
<Resource name="jdbc/Servauto" auth="Container" type="javax.sql.DataSource"/>
<ResourceParams name="jdbc/Servauto">
<parameter>
<name>driverClassName</name>
<value>oracle.jdbc.driver.OracleDriver</value>
</parameter>
<parameter>
<name>url</name>
<value>jdbc:oracle:thin:@localhost:1521:SERVAUTO </value>
</parameter>
<parameter>
<name>username</name>
<value>system</value>
</parameter>
<parameter>
<name>password</name>
<value>sara_system</value>
</parameter>
<parameter>
<name>maxActive</name>
<value>50</value>
</parameter>
<parameter>
<name>maxWait</name>
<value>100</value>
</parameter>
<parameter>
<name>removeAbandoned</name>
<value>true</value>
</parameter>
<parameter>
<name>removeAbandonedTimeout</name>
<value>15</value>
</parameter>
</ResourceParams>
</DefaultContext>






***El web.xml de mi aplicacion lo he puesto asi:

<resource-ref>
<res-ref-name>jdbc/Servauto</res-ref-name>
<res-type>javax.sql.DataSource</res-type>
<res-auth>Container</res-auth>
</resource-ref>
</web-app>


*****He hecho un servlet de prueba:

InitialContext initCtx = new InitialContext();
DataSource ds = (DataSource) initCtx.lookup("jdbc/Servauto");
Connection conn = ds.getConnection();
Statement stmt = conn.createStatement();
ResultSet rset = stmt.executeQuery("select * from ejercicio;");
out.println(rset.getString(1));
out.println(rset.getString(2));
out.println(rset.getString(3));



****Bueno entonces desplego la aplicacion enel TomCat y ejecuto el servlet y me da este errro:

"El nombre jdbc no este asociado a este contexto"


A ver si podeis ayudarme. Un saludo.Gracias
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 19:38.